T Wave
A feature on an electrocardiogram (ECG) representing the repolarization of the ventricles of the heart.
R Wave
Part of the QRS complex in an electrocardiogram (ECG) representing ventricular depolarization, which precedes ventricular contraction.
Heart Skeleton
A framework of dense connective tissue in the heart that provides structural support and attachment for cardiac muscle and valves.
Ectopic Stimuli
Electrical or chemical signals occurring at an abnormal location or time in the body, often resulting in irregular physiological responses such as ectopic heartbeats.
